
Dual JFET operational amplifier featuring a 1.7MHz gain bandwidth product and 4V/µs slew rate. This BIFET technology amplifier offers a low input bias current of 5pA and an input offset voltage of 150µV. With a high common mode rejection ratio of 86dB and power supply rejection ratio of 88dB, it operates from a minimum supply voltage of 9V up to 40V. Packaged in an 8-pin DIP, this lead-free and RoHS compliant component is suitable for general amplification applications.
